Prepaid plan of Rs 449 for Vi
Compared to Airtel and Jio, Telecom Giant is offering a prepaid plan of Rs 449 here. In this, you get unlimited calling facility. At the same time, you also get 2 GB daily data and 100 SMS daily. This plan also comes with a double data offer. The validity of the plan is 56 days.
Airtel prepaid plan of Rs 558
If you talk about Airtel’s prepaid plan of Rs 558, then you get the facility of Truly Unlimited Calls, 3 GB Daily Data and 100 SMS. This plan also comes with a validity of 56 days. Currently, this 3 GB plan is the cheapest plan. In this case, a plan of Rs 558 will be the best for you, because the plan of Rs 398 offers 28 days validity. Please tell that Airtel does not currently have a 4 GB data plan.
Jio prepaid plan of Rs 444
Jio does not have a 4 GB prepaid plan. But you can choose a plan of 3 GB. Here you get validity of 28 and 84 days. You can also get a Jio Recharge Pack of Rs 444, in which you get 2 GB of daily data, unlimited calling and 100 SMS daily. This validity is 56 days.
You can also take a plan of 349 rupees where you get 3 GB data daily, unlimited calls and 100 SMS daily. But the validity of the plan is only 28 days. Here you can also get a plan of 11 rupees where you get 1 GB of data. At the same time, 6 GB data is available for 51 rupees and 12 GB data for 101 rupees. You can get 30 GB for 151 rupees, 40 GB for 201 rupees and 50 GB data for 251 rupees. In all, you get a validity of 30 days.
